The promotion of conservation agriculture (CA) for smallholders in sub-Saharan Africa is subject to ongoing scholarly and public debate regarding the evidence-base and the agenda-setting power of involved stakeholders. We undertake a political analysis of CA in Zambia that combines a qualitative case study of a flagship CA initiative with a quantitative analysis of a nationally representative dataset on agricultural practices. This analysis moves from an investigation of the knowledge politics to a study of how the political agendas of the actors involved are shaping agrarian practices. From its initial focus on CA as soil conservation and sustainable agriculture, the framing of the initiative has evolved to accommodate shifting trends in the policy arena. In tandem with the increased focus on climate adaptation, we see an increased emphasis on private sector-led modernisation. The initiative has shifted its target group from the poorest smallholders to prospective commercial farmers, and has forged connections between its farmer-to-farmer extension network and private input suppliers and service providers. The link between CA and input intensification is reflected in national statistics as a significantly higher usage of herbicides, pesticides and mineral fertilizer on fields under CA tillage compared to other fields. We argue that the environmental and participation agendas are used to buttress CA as an environmentally and socially sustainable agricultural development strategy, while the prevailing practice is the result of a common vision for a private sector-led agricultural development shared between the implementing organisation, the donor and international organisations promoting a new green revolution in Africa. 相似文献

Many bird species respond to forestry, even at moderate intensities. In New Brunswick, Canada, the Brown Creeper exhibits a negative, threshold response to harvesting intensity. This study aimed to determine whether (a) the threshold found in Brown Creeper occurrence is lower than eventual thresholds in its nesting requirements, and whether (b) the conservation of this species could be achieved through moderate-intensity harvest systems. Creepers are particularly sensitive to forestry because they nest on snags with peeling bark and they mainly forage on large-diameter trees. In northern hardwood stands, we compared habitat structure at local- (r = 80 m) and neighbourhood-scales (r = 250 m) around nest sites and sites not used by creepers. Over two years, we found 76 nests, 66 of which were paired with unused sites for comparison. At the local scale, densities of trees 30 cm dbh and snags 10 cm dbh, and the probability of presence of potential nest sites were significantly higher near nests than at sites where no creepers were detected. At the neighbourhood scale, the area of untreated mature forest was significantly higher around nests. Variance decomposition indicated that habitat variables at the local scale accounted for the majority of explained variation in nest site selection. We also found significant thresholds in the densities of large trees (127/ha) and snags (56/ha), and in the area of mature forest (10.4 ha). The conservation of breeding populations of Brown Creepers may thus require densities of large trees nearly twice as high as those associated with its probability of presence. Such a target seems to be incompatible even with moderate-intensity harvesting. 相似文献

Differences in attack of the spruce gall aphid Sacchiphantes abietis L. in a Norway spruce progeny trial
The occurence of galls caused by the spruce gall aphid (Sacchiphantes abietis L.) was studied on young Norway spruce progeny from 9 different full sib families with parents from Sweden and Western Europe. The frequency of galls was found to vary significantly with genetic origin. Time for bud flushing did not influence the frequency of galls. Attacked trees had on verage better height increment than trees without galls. Galls on the leading shoot reduced height increment. The frequency of galls was positively influenced by the occurence of prolepsis. The abundance of hibernating aphids was positively correlated to the frequency of galls.

Isolation and characterisation of Plesiomonas shigelloides from fresh water in Northern Europe is reported in this study. The organisms were isolated from two lakes and a river in Sweden. All isolates of P. shigelloides showed an identical biochemical profile and belonged to different serotypes, namely, O18, O23, O26, O58 and O60. The study indicates that P. shigelloides may occur in the aquatic environment of cold climates and as a result, it is likely to be associated with human infections caused by waterborne pathogens in geographical areas with similar climatic conditions. 相似文献

Forestry in Sweden as well as in other European countries is characterised by intense and increasing international competition
resulting in decreasing roundwood prices in real terms. This is especially the situation in the mountainous region of Sweden
with long transportation distances between the felling site and the processing industries located at the coast. The question
arises whether forestry must be run more extensively than at present to achieve the optimal rate of silvicultural activities
compared with the amount of timber cut. With this in mind, optimising economic analyses have been performed at the stand level
as well as at the level of forest estates. Results of the analyses reveal that more intensive thinning (more frequent operations)
and shorter rotation periods would increase profit and offset continuously decreasing roundwood prices. Intensive pre-commercial
thinning (cleaning) is especially important for profitability of the subsequent thinnings and the final cut. The large number
of cuts during the rotation will increase logging costs. However, this will be more than offset by the increasing production
of economically matured dimensions of timber, an effect that will be still more pronounced when using new harvesting technology.
Moreover, frequent high thinning operations (thinning ‘from above’ or removal of dominant trees) will result in more dense
wood close to the pith, more evenly distributed year rings, and fewer and smaller knots in the lower part of the stem — in
other words more valuable roundwood which will justify high transportation costs. Several biological and technical aspects
of these treatment programs are discussed in the paper. 相似文献

Integrated approaches to forest planning lead to large models and there is a subsequent need for a reduction of the number of constraints and variables. One way of achieving this is to aggregate data, either spatially or temporally. In this paper an integrated forest planning mixed integer model that takes into account both long-term strategic and shorter-term tactical forest management decisions is utilised. The study analyses the consequences of temporal aggregation in the strategic part of the integrated model, whereas the tactical part is modelled by a fixed set of years divided into seasons. For reference, analyses are also made using a pure strategic linear programming model. Cases using both equal and variable strategic period lengths are presented, and two case study areas are used. Results indicate that integrated plans, as well as strategic plans, are not particularly affected by the number of equal length strategic periods when more than five periods, i.e. less than 20 year period length, are used. When modelling strategic and integrated problems using variable-length periods, care should be taken to ensure that harvest operations late in the planning horizon get enough timing options to be adequately described. 相似文献

The marine flagellated Chlorophyta Tetraselmis suecica is among the most important live food species in marine aquaculture. In the present study, the effects of dietary supplementation of dried marine microalgae, Tetraselmis suecica, on growth performance; feed utilization; chemical composition; gene expression of superoxide dismutase (SOD), glutathione peroxidase (GPx) and insulin‐like growth factor 2 (IGF‐II) gene of Pacific white shrimp, Litopenaeus vannamei; muscle protein polymorphism; and microbial count were assessed and evaluated. Three hundred and sixty L. vannamei (postlarvae) Pls (0.124 ± 0.002 g) were randomly stocked into 40‐L glass aquaria (30 shrimp/aquarium) and fed three times daily four tested diets: a basal diet (control), diet incorporated with 2.5 g kg?1 dried T. suecica (T1), 5 g kg?1 dried T. suecica (T2) and 7.5 g kg?1 dried T. suecica (T3) in triplicates, for 90 days. At the end of the trial, the survival rate (SR) of L. vannamei fed diets supplemented with different levels of T. suecica was significantly (p < .05) higher than the control diet. The highest weight gain and specific growth rate and the best feed conversion ratio were recorded on L. vannamei fed a diet supplemented with a 7.5 g/kg dried T. suecica. The highest protein, lipid and ash contents were obtained in L. vannamei fed the diet containing 7.5 g/kg T. suecica, when compared with the remaining tested diets. The gene expression of antioxidant genes SOD and GPx was the lowest in the T3 group in comparison with the control group. Meanwhile, expression level of IGF‐II was higher in the T2 group. The total heterotrophic bacterial count was significantly (p < .05) increased with the cumulative T. suecica level, while no significant (p > .05) differences were found in the total Vibrio count among treatments. Overall, the present results have shown that the diet supplemented with the highest inclusion level of dried T. suecica resulted in improved growth and nutrient utilization. 相似文献

While populations of other migratory salmonids suffer in the Anthropocene, pink salmon (Oncorhynchus gorbusca Salmonidae) are thriving, and their distribution is expanding both within their natural range and in the Atlantic and Arctic following introduction of the species to the White Sea in the 1950s. Pink salmon are now rapidly spreading in Europe and even across the ocean to North America. Large numbers of pink salmon breed in Norwegian rivers and small numbers of individuals have been captured throughout the North Atlantic since 2017. Although little is known about the biology and ecology of the pink salmon in its novel distribution, the impacts of the species' introduction are potentially highly significant for native species and watershed productivity. Contrasts between pink salmon in the native and extended ranges will be key to navigating management strategies for Atlantic nations where the pink salmon is entrenching itself among the fish fauna, posing potential threats to native fish communities. One key conclusion of this paper is that the species' heritable traits are rapidly selected and drive local adaptation and evolution. Within the Atlantic region, this may facilitate further establishment and spread. The invasion of pink salmon in the Atlantic basin is ultimately a massive ecological experiment and one of the first examples of a major faunal change in the North Atlantic Ocean that is already undergoing rapid changes due to other anthropogenic stressors. New research is urgently needed to understand the role and potential future impacts of pink salmon in Atlantic ecosystems. 相似文献

Changes in Phytoavailability and Concentration of Cadmium in Soil Following Long Term Salix Cropping
Cadmium concentrations in Salix (willow) shoots are generally high and Salix can therefore potentially remove significant amounts of Cd from soil. The aim of this study was to investigate how long-term Salix cultivation had affected total and plant available Cd concentrations in agricultural soil. The study was made in 8 to 30 yr old plantations. Soil profiles down to 65 cm depth were sampled and conditions within the plantations were compared to those in nearby reference areas. When consideration was given to certain pH differences, concentrations of exchangeable Cd throughout the soil profiles were significantly lower in the Salix stands than in the reference areas. However, the effect on concentrations of total Cd was negligible. The yield levels proved not to be optimal and Cd concentrations in shoots were lower than average in the investigated stands. Data on exchangeable Cd show that uptake occurs throughout the soil profile and the Cd pool involved is thus large. These facts may explain why total concentrations were only slightly influenced. The conclusion reached was that Salix cultivation reduces the amount of plant-available Cd in the soil. However, more investigations are needed to evaluate how this effect can be optimized by choice of clone and other management measures. 相似文献

OBJECTIVE: To compare application time, accuracy of tibial plateau slope (TPS) correction, presence and magnitude of rotational and angular deformities, and mechanical properties of 5 canine tibial plateau leveling methods. SAMPLE POPULATION: 27 canine tibial replicas created by rapid prototyping methods. PROCEDURE: The application time, accuracy of TPS correction, presence and magnitude of rotational and angular deformation, and construct axial stiffness of 3 internal fixation methods (tibial plateau leveling osteotomy, tibial wedge osteotomy, and chevron wedge osteotomy [CWO]) and 2 external skeletal fixation (ESF) methods (hinged hybrid circular external fixation and wedge osteotomy linear fixation [WOLF]) were assessed. RESULTS: Mean bone model axial stiffness did not differ among methods. Mean application time was more rapid for WOLF than for other methods. Mean TPSs did not differ from our 5 degrees target and were lower for ESF methods, compared with internal fixation methods. Mean postoperative rotational malalignment did not differ from our target or among groups. Mean postoperative medio-lateral angulation did not differ from our target, except for CWO. Internal fixation methods lead to axially stiffer constructs than ESF methods. Reuse of ESF frames did not lead to a decrease in axial stiffness. CONCLUSIONS AND CLINICAL RELEVANCE: The 5 tibial plateau leveling methods had acceptable geometric and mechanical properties. External skeletal fixation methods were more accurate as a result of precise data available for determining the exact magnitude of correction required to achieve a 5 degrees TPS. 相似文献
